1. 介绍 Merkle Patricia Tree(简称MPT树,实际上是一种trie前缀树)是以太坊中的一种加密认证的数据结构,可以用来存储所有的(key,value)对。以太坊区块的头部包括一个区...
转载
2019-05-17 21:11:00
916阅读
MPT详解1. 前言1.1 概述1.2 前缀树1.3 默克尔树2. 结构设计2.1 节点分类2.2 key值编码2.3 安全的MPT3. 基本操作3.1 Get3.2 Insert3.3 Delete3.4 Update3.5 Commit4. 轻节点扩展4.1 什么是轻节点
转载
2022-12-27 12:54:47
344阅读
上篇主要介绍了以太坊中的MPT树的原理,这篇主要会对MPT树涉及的源码进行拆解分析。trie模块主要有以下几个文件:|-encoding.go 主要讲编码之间的转换
|-hasher.go 实现了从某个结点开始计算子树的哈希的功能
|-node.go 定义了一个Trie树中所有结点的类型和解析的代码
|-sync.go 实现了SyncTrie对象的定义和所有方法
|-iterator.go 定义了
转载
2021-01-22 22:10:46
556阅读
2评论
CCITT(国际电报电话咨询委员会) No.7信号方式是国际性的通用公共信道信号系统,特点如下: 一.最适合程控交换机的数字电信网 二.能满足具有呼叫控制,遥控及管理和维护信号的电信网中,处理机间事务处理信息传递的要求 三.能提供可靠的方法,使信息正确传递而不丢失或重复 本系统最适合采用64kb/s的数字通道,也适合模拟信道和以较低速率的工作.一般采用PCM30的第16
% %demo1% A=rand(3,10);% pbound=Polyhedron([0 0 0;150 0 0;150 150 0;0 150 0; 0 0 1;150 0 1;150 150 1;0 150 1]);% V=mpt_voronoi(A,'bound',pbound);% plo
转载
2016-12-29 14:33:00
200阅读
转载于:Merkle Patricia Tree 详解 1. 前言 1.1 概述 Merkle Patricia Tree(又称为Merkle Patricia Trie)是一种经过改良的、融合了默克尔树和前缀树两种树结构优点的数据结构,是以太坊中用来组织管理账户数据、生成交易集合哈希的重要数据结构 ...
转载
2021-10-01 22:13:00
698阅读
2评论
Merkle Patricia Tree [1],梅克尔帕特里夏树,提供了一个基于加
转载
2019-05-11 16:54:00
271阅读
2评论
TE二次开发:mpt
原创
2022-09-27 16:15:30
183阅读
的缩写为(Multipurpose Internet Mail Extensions)代表互联网媒体类型(Internet media type),MIME使用一个简单的字符串组成,最初是为了标识邮件Email附件的类型,在html文件中可以使用content-type属性表示,描述了文件类型的互联网标准。类型能包含视频、图像、文本、音频、应用程序等数据。Android开发中也会常常涉及到这已概念
转载
2023-09-07 15:21:54
56阅读
技术交流群:665060698 地图影像文件的数量级都比较大,几百M到几个G,初次用arcgis打开一个影像文件,首先会创建金字塔,金字塔里边包含一堆大图片和小图片,让这些工具显示起来都比较快,毕竟影像文件(下图380M的影像尺寸)是一个有坐标的尺寸很
原创
2018-06-27 11:25:38
1154阅读
点赞
读取、写入和 Python在 “探索 Python” 系列以前的文章中,学习了基本的 Python 数据类型和一些容器数据类型,例如tuple、string 和 list。其他文章讨论了 Python 语言的条件和循环特性,以及它们如何与容器数据类型进行协作来简化编程任务。编写程序的最后一个基本步骤就是从文件读取数据和把数据写入文件。阅读完这篇文章之后,可以在自己的 to-do 列表中加上检验这个
转载
2024-10-15 10:05:12
34阅读
生成mpt的金字塔简析
原创
2022-09-27 23:11:37
611阅读
报错1:使用正确的UDF文件仍然提示The UDF library you are trying to load(libudf2) is not compiled for parallel use on the current platform(win64).:UDF文件需要放在FLUENT的工作路径下报错2:received a fatal signal(aborted)(segmentatio
需求:app本地检查更新,后台有新版apk则下载新版apk并安装。业务逻辑流程图基本上是这样的 :查阅的一些资料后基本上得到三种解决方案:1,AsyncTask+Http下载;2,DownloadManager;3,Service+Http下载;而DownloadManager(以下表示为DM)相对来说比较简单这里就选择第二种方案:DM是一种处理长时间运行的HTTP下载的系统服务。客户端可以通过U
转载
2023-09-17 07:44:49
304阅读
转自:http://www.myexception.cn/go/1898027.html 利用GoogleEarth影像制作Skyline MPT案例说明本案例实现内容:影像的获取、Skyline TerraBuilder制作MPT、利用Skyline TerraExplorer 加载本地MPT文件
转载
2016-05-24 11:17:00
102阅读
2评论
转自:http://www.cnblogs.com/cannel/p/3622447.html MPT是skyline独有的三维地形数据格式,可简单理解为 影像图+高程=三维地形(三维底图),以下介绍用skyline TerraBuilder(以下简称TB)制作MPT的方法与技巧 用TB制作MPT,
转载
2015-09-17 08:16:00
263阅读
2评论
本文转自:http://www.cnblogs.com/cannel/p/3622811.html制作MPT的方法可以看这里《skyline TerraBuilder 制作MPT方法与技巧(1)》http://www.cnblogs.com/cannel/p/3622447.html用TB制作MPT...
转载
2015-09-17 08:21:00
89阅读
2评论
B+树 B+ Tree定义B+树是一种多路平衡查找树,是对B树(B-Tree)的扩展. 首先,一个M阶的B树的定义为:每个节点最多有M个子节点;每一个非叶子节点(除根节点)至少有ceil(M/2)个子节点;如果根节点不是叶子节点,那么至少有两个子节点;有k个子节点的非叶子节点拥有k-1个键,键按照升序排列;所有叶子节点在同一层;从定义可以看出来,一个M阶的B树,其叶子节点必须在同一层,每一个节点的
转载
2023-08-25 10:52:20
27阅读
红黑树,一个很牛x的数据结构,作为目前JDK的hashmap的底层,是一个兼顾了空间和时间的完美二叉查找树,在AVL的平衡性上做出了巨大改进。首先它的本质是一种特殊的AVL树,祖父辈是二叉排序树,就是那个左子节点必定小于等于它,右子节点必定大于它的树。 首先要了解红黑树就要从他的基本性质说起,1.根节点必定为黑色2.不能有两个连接的红色节点 3.节点颜色只能为红或者黑 4.任意节点到每个叶子节点途
转载
2023-08-19 20:26:37
23阅读
【描述】: 无向图的最短路径 — Dijkstra(适用于非负权值边)【输入】:【输出】:顶点 距离(与源点)0 01 32 5ra(不适用于负权值的边)*/
原创
2022-10-28 12:15:52
79阅读